ELECTRICITY The impedance in one part of a series circuit is 1 + 3j ohms and the impedance in another part of the circuit is 7 -
TiliK225 [7]

Answer:

Total impedance in circuit = 8 - 2j ohms

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

Circuit one = 1 + 3j ohms

Circuit two = 7 - 5j ohms

Find:

Total impedance in circuit

Computation:

Total impedance in circuit = Circuit one + Circuit two

Total impedance in circuit = 1 + 3j + 7 - 5j

Total impedance in circuit = 8 - 2j ohms

Consider parallelogram ABCD with vertices at A(−10,6), B(−5.5,26), C(9.5,18), and D(5,−2). What is the perimeter, in units, of p
monitta

Given vertices of parallelogram ABCD:

A(−10,6), B(−5.5,26), C(9.5,18), and D(5,−2).

<u>Length of AB is :</u>

=\sqrt{\left(-5.5-\left(-10\right)\right)^2+\left(26-6\right)^2}= 20.5.

<u>Length of BC is : </u>

=\sqrt{\left(9.5-\left(-5.5\right)\right)^2+\left(18-26\right)^2} =17.

Note, opposite sides of a parallelogram are equal.

Therefore,

<em>Perimeter of parallelogram ABCD = 2 × Length of AB + 2 × Length of BC.</em>

Perimeter = 2 × 20.5 + 2 × 17

                 = 41 + 34

                 = 75 units.

<h3>Therefore, the perimeter of parallelogram ABCD is 75 units.</h3>
